Effects of common oilfield chemicals on oily wastewater treatment impact

Fund Project:

Abstract: The effects of common oilfield chemicals in produced crud oil in Jianghan Oilfield on the coagulation of oily wastewater were investigated by means of water quality analyses and coagulation tests.The relationships between the coagulants, common oilfield chemicals and turbidities and the percentage removal of oil contents were discussed. The interaction mechanisms of the effects of common oilfield chemicals on oily wastewater treatment were preliminary analysed. It demonstrates that the coagulations of drilling water, fracturing water, acidizing liquid and perforation liquid are influenced mainly by tannin, SMP and K-PAM, guar gum and potassium dichromate, acetic acid and citric acid, and hydrochloride, respectively. This work is valuable for eliminating the deteriorative impacts of common oilfield chemicals on oil production, enhancing oil recovery and preventing environmental pollutions.
